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ups heavy cream
  • 14 ounces sweetened condensed milk
  • ½ te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up creamy peanut butter

Instructions

  1. In a large bowl, combine the heavy cream, sweetened condensed milk, and vanilla extract using a hand mixer or stand mixer until well mixed. Set aside.
  2. In a heatproof bowl, add all the peanut butter and heat it for 15-20 seconds on high to make pouring easier.
  3. Pour about ¼ cup of the warmed peanut butter into the ice cream mixture and mix on high speed until smooth and thick, about 3-5 minutes.
  4. Spoon ⅓ of the ice cream mixture into a freezer-safe container, then layer half of the melted peanut butter over it. Spread evenly with a spatula.
  5. Add another ⅓ of the ice cream, followed by the remaining melted peanut butter and the last ⅓ of the ice cream mixture.
  6. Use a butter knife to swirl the peanut butter throughout the ice cream mixture.
  7. Cover tightly and freeze for at least 8 hours or overnight. The ice cream is good for up to 3 months in the freezer.

Notes

For a stronger peanut butter flavor, feel free to add more peanut butter in between the layers.
Make sure to use heavy cream for a rich texture and taste.
You can substitute the creamy peanut butter with any nut butter of your choice.
